|
Как в выборке справочника установить отбор 1с 83 |
☑ |
0
program345
22.02.15
✎
19:17
|
Добрый вечер!
есть код:
//
Выборка = Справочники.ВариантыОбедов.Выбрать(,,Новый Структура("ПометкаУдаления",ложь));
//
Хочу брать все элементы справочинка без пометки удаления..
выдает ошибку, как исправить?
|
|
1
program345
22.02.15
✎
19:19
|
прочитал СП:
<Отбор> (необязательный)
Тип: Структура.
Задает поле и значение отбора открываемой выборки. Ключ структуры описывает имя поля, а значение структуры - значение отбора по этому полю. В качестве полей для отбора могут задаваться только поля "Код", "Наименование" и реквизиты справочника, для которых в конфигураторе признак индексирования установлен в значение "Индексировать" или в значение "Индексировать с доп. упорядоч.".
|
|
2
PR
22.02.15
✎
19:19
|
Правильно так:
Запрос = Новый Запрос("ВЫБРАТЬ ...
|
|
3
ДенисЧ
22.02.15
✎
19:21
|
блин... Не клиент.
У него СП есть и читать умеет (((
|
|
4
program345
22.02.15
✎
19:27
|
вот решение
запросом тоже моно
//
Выборка = Справочники.ВариантыОбедов.Выбрать();
Пока Выборка.Следующий() Цикл
Если Выборка.ПометкаУдаления Тогда
Продолжить;
КонецЕсли;
СписокЗн.Добавить(Выборка.Наименование);
КонецЦикла;
//
|
|
5
ДенисЧ
22.02.15
✎
19:30
|
(4) Not hired! Next please.
|
|